易语言:按最小化按钮把软件最小化到托盘并弹出对话框问题

2024-12-29 13:12:11
推荐回答(3个)
回答1:

.版本 2

.程序集 窗口程序集1

.子程序 __启动窗口_托盘事件
.参数 操作类型, 整数型

.判断开始 (操作类型 = 2)
.判断开始 (_启动窗口.可视 = 真)
_启动窗口.可视 = 假
.默认
载入 (_启动窗口, , 真)
置托盘图标 (, )
.判断结束

.判断 (操作类型 = 3)
弹出菜单 (菜单, , )
.默认

.判断结束

—————其中,操作类型=3,为右键弹出,=2为左键双击的事件————

回答2:

虽然我不是学易得,但是给你个思路,对该窗体进行子类化,从子类化函数中拦截最小化消息,在该消息处理中将窗体隐藏,并在其托盘上弹出气泡窗口,在气泡窗口中显示一些提示信息

回答3:

置托盘 命令